Ticket: Tideframe widget failing for several plugin authors since Monday. Root cause: the credential bundle issued for the internal tide-table service, Moonpull, expired and was not auto-renewed. Widgets calling Moonpull's predictions endpoint receive 401 responses; cached tables still render but show stale timestamps. A fresh credential has been provisioned and plugin scaffolds will be updated in the next release. Until then, configure your development instance with the replacement key below.

service key, yadug-bajog: zpat3_pou

Action item from the Ferndock outage: finish the leaked-file-descriptor hunt in the ingest daemon. We capped the bleed with a ulimit bump, but that's a band-aid — sockets from failed upstream retries still aren't closed. Rico owns the fix; target is end of sprint. Repro steps, lsof captures, and suspect code paths are collected on the internal tracking page.

runbook for badug-kadup: https://confluence.zemvarlabs.internal/projects/browse/display/projects/bd1b

### Alert: GLAZE_CACHE_STALE

Heads up, plugin folks: this fires when the Glazework tile-rendering cache serves entries older than its 10-minute TTL for more than 5% of requests. Usually it means your plugin is stamping tiles with bad cache keys, or the invalidation hook isn't registered. Check your manifest's `onTileDirty` binding first — that fixes it nine times out of ten. If the alert persists after a redeploy, don't guess; drop a note to the Glazework cache team.

alerts address for bajop-yahog: istwyn@lumiclabs.internal

# NOTE for maintainers: this module is mid-extraction from the Corvalt
# monolith. User auth moved to the Penna service; profile reads still hit
# the legacy store. Do not add new callers here. Batch sizes and retry
# windows below were tuned during the Q3 cutover and are load-bearing.
# The constants are as follows:

tuning table, bagep-tahof:
RATE_LIMITS = {
    "ralael": 10,
    "druath": 5,
}

**Checklist — FeedSentry validator cut.** Reviewer: confirm RSS and Atom fixtures pass, enclosure-size edge cases covered, and the new namespace whitelist matches spec. Check that malformed pubDate handling no longer throws. Lint clean, no snapshot churn. Verify the Oakrill staging feed validates end-to-end before approving. Sign off only against the exact artifact; the build trace token for this cut is listed directly below.

trace token, kawip-fafog: htk14_26e64c4d35154e